Write when you have high energy
I used to write after my 9–5 because of one reason:
I’m not a morning person.
It took me months to realize it made no sense to write after a tiring day. The best time to write is when your energy is highest.
For most people, their energy is highest in the morning.
Yet everyone thinks otherwise because they spend their mornings like this:
- Wake up
- Snooze alarm
- Snooze 10x more
- Scroll on social media
If you want to stop feeling groggy in the morning, Follow these simple ways to protect your energy:
- Avoid snoozing alarm (it disrupts your sleep pattern)
- Get high-quality sleep (maintain a healthy sleep schedule & environment)
- Create (instead of consuming information)
